Cristiano passes Ronaldo on Real Madrid scoring list to take 14th spot on the all time scoring list. He also has the best average of goal per game ever recorded for a RM player - 0.96 GPG with 104 goals in 106 games. Only Puskas comes close with 242 goals in 262 games, average of 0.92 GPG.
